    How to Fix a Dead Kia Picanto Key Fob

    The Kia Picanto is a city vehicle that can navigate traffic gaps and width restrictions as if they weren't there. Despite its ugly appearance it is packed with plenty of kit.

    Dead Coin Battery

    A dead battery is the most frequent reason of a Kia Picanto's keys fob not working. The key fob can show warning signs, such as unpredictable behavior or loss of range before it dies. If you notice any of these warning signs, it's best to replace the battery before it fails completely. Be sure to choose the same replacement battery with the same size, voltage and specifications as your original one.

    If the key fob not working, you may need to take it to a dealer. This is the only way of ensuring the replacement is programmed correctly and compatible with your vehicle. Attempting to reprogram your key fob in the absence of correct procedure could damage the chip inside and cause it to stop functioning.

    Another possibility is that the receiver module has developed an issue. This could be the result of an unintentional chip damage or wear and tear that occurs over time. The signs of this issue can be difficult to spot, but it is important to determine the cause as soon as you can. If you're not able to find your key fob that will lock or unlock your doors, or if even the spare isn't working then you should call a dealership or service center to get help. They'll be able to identify the issue and fix it for you.

    Faulty Chip

    The key fob has an internal chip that transmits a signal to the car's computer. If the chip gets corrupted it will not transmit the correct code and the car's immobilizer system will be activated. This could be due to many reasons. One reason could be low battery levels in the key fob. Another one is water damage. If the fob gets wet, it's likely that it will cease to function.

    A damaged chip may be the reason behind an Picanto key fob not turning on the engine. If you have replaced the battery and tried reprogramming the fob, but it doesn't work, it could be that the circuit board is damaged. If this is the case, you'll have to replace kia car key it.

    Press the button on the back to open the fob. After that, you will be able to take off the mechanical key. Then, follow the steps below to replace the key fob's battery. Make sure you choose a new battery that is the same voltage and size. Using the wrong type of battery could cause damage to the Fob. After replacing the battery, you should test it by pressing the lock button. If it is working, you've got a fantastic Fob.

    Faulty Receiver Module

    Your key fob isn't indestructible and takes a lot abuse. Over time, the buttons and battery contacts of your key fob could become damaged. It's easy to fix it using a few tools.

    To function, the fob needs to send a signal through a receiver in your car. If the module is inoperable, your fob will not be able of opening or starting your car. There are several different possibilities for the cause of this issue but the first step to try is resetting the fob.

    This is done by disconnecting and let the battery of 12 volts drain completely. Then, reconnecting the negative and positive cables in reverse order.

    If the battery is in good shape and the fob doesn't have any water damage, the issue could be due to the signal. This could be caused by a variety of things including interference from nearby transmitters or objects that use the same frequency band as the Picanto's receiver.

    Key fobs have rubber seals that prevent the electronic chip from becoming wet. However should they be submerged in water, the chips could be damaged. This is why it's important to keep your key fob free from water, and to only use a key fob with an waterproof design.
